Sunshine state young readers award books 2019 2020 list. The sunshine state young readers award ssyra program is a statewide reading motivational program for students in grades 3 through 8. The purpose of the ssyra program is to encourage students to read independently for pleasure and to read books that are on, above, and below their reading level in order to improve their reading fluency.
